Amanda WilliamsWe investigate the use of parabolic equation (PE) methods for solving radio-wave propagation in polar ice. PE methods provide an approximate solution to Maxwell's equations, in contrast to full-field solutions such as finite-difference-time-domain (FDTD) methods, yet provide a more complete model of propagation than simple geometric ray-tracing (RT) methods that are the current state of the ...

D 107 , 043026 - Published 22 February 2023 MoreIn the latest work, Steven Prohira of Ohio State University and colleagues exploit an “active” means of radio detection – in the form of radar echoes. This relies on the fact that a particle cascade moving through a material at near the speed of light will kick out electrons from atoms within the material. Jun 28, 2022 · The successful candidate would work primarily on the Radar Echo Telescope (RET) experiment in Dr. Steven Prohira's research group. The University of Kansas is the lead US institution on the RET experiment, working to make the first radio detection of ultrahigh energy neutrinos using active radar sounding. Nov 18, 2020 · Steven Prohira is a neutrino hunter. The postdoctoral researcher at Ohio State's Center for Cosmology and AstroParticle Physics is principal investigator on a new project, the NSF-funded Radar Echo Telescope, which uses radar to detect neutrinos, tiny particles key to understanding the mysteries of the universe.
